Kimmel was relieved of his command of the U.S. Pacific Fleet as part of a shake-up of … WebNov 18, 2024 · The Pearl Harbor National Wildlife Refuge was established on October 17, 1972 to mitigate the environmental impacts of the construction of the Honolulu International Airport Reef Runway. It protects some of the last remaining wetlands on Oahu and is home to threatened and endangered wildlife and plants, such as the Hawaiian stilt and the akoko. WebDec 3, 2024 · On 7 December 1941, the Imperial Japanese Navy attacked the US naval base of Pearl Harbor in Oahu, Hawaii. The bombardment was intended as a pre-emptive strike, despite the United States being a neutral country at the time.
